SKEMA student Mathieu Merian wins 'Les Victoires by GARANCE'

Published on 07 November 2023

Having recently showcased his prototypes at the Bourget Air Show and having presented his exoskeleton project to army executives, Mathieu Merian, a fourth-year Global BBA student at SKEMA Business School, has added another feather to his cap. Somanity, a startup co-founded by him that is incubated at SKEMA Ventures, has won the "Les Victoires by GARANCE" entrepreneurship award, securing a grant of €50,000.

mathieusomanity

​​After winning the entrepreneurship award from Fondation Université Côte d'Azur, our student Mathieu Merian's Somanity has won over the jury of Les Victoires by GARANCE, an entrepreneurial initiative of the GARANCE group, specialists in innovative and comprehensive personal insurance. 

Somanity is a startup that specialises in the manufacturing of medical-use exoskeletons. "The grant will help us speed up the commercialisation process by better equipping us," said Mathieu Merian, following his win. Competing with 100 projects and 16 finalists, Mathieu Merian and Somanity have demonstrated with this prestigious award that the ingenuity and utility of the 3D-printed exoskeletons have a bright future. This medical device, initially costly, will soon be available for less than €10,000. This represents a significant advancement in the health and mobility sectors.


Incubated at SKEMA Ventures, supported by ESA


Mathieu Merian is incubated at SKEMA Ventures, the incubator-accelerator of SKEMA, and is supported by the European Space Agency (ESA). He is working with various medical institutions and is looking at the defence and aerospace sectors for new applications for his product. Here's hoping the winning streak continues for Mathieu!
